PP&E (Property, Plant and Equipment)

Property, plant, and equipment basically includes any of a company's long-term, fixed assets. PP&E assets are tangible, identifiable, and expected to generate an economic return for the company for more than one year or one operating cycle (whichever is longer). Plant, machinery and equipment | SafeWork NSW

Plant includes machinery, equipment, appliances, containers, implements and tools and components or anything fitted or connected to those things. Some examples of plant include lifts, cranes, computers, machinery, scaffolding components, conveyors, forklifts, augers, vehicles, power tools and amusement devices. Construction work in progress definition — AccountingTools

What is Construction Work in Progress? Construction work in progress is a general ledger account in which the costs to construct a fixed asset are recorded. What is construction plant and why is it important?

Plant downtime refers to when the plant is not operating. This may be scheduled downtime such as essential maintenance, or unscheduled due to breakdown or a lack of work. Construction companies are keen to minimise construction downtime as much as possible as it is one of the main causes of lost productivity.

Property, plant, and equipment definition — AccountingTools

Property, plant, and equipment (PP&E) includes tangible items that are expected to be used in more than one and that are used in production, for rental, or for administration. This can include items acquired for safety or environmental reasons. In certain asset-intensive industries, PP&E is the largest class of assets.
